A <u>Literary</u> summary is a synopsis of the events, characters, and ideas in a work of literature.

In literature, a literary summary covers all the important part of the narrative which includes protagonist, antagonist, plot, character, conflict, theme and other important elements. It involves analyzing the major elements in a literary work.

<h2>Further Explanation</h2>

The synopsis or summary of the events provides a hint of what the literary work is all about. It gives the audience the idea of the work and provides brief details or the major points and other important elements of the work.

A writer must not assume that its audience or readers know everything about their work, so it is important to provide an overview of what the work is all about.

The best synopsis format is to start your work with a strong paragraph by revealing the protagonist, conflict, and setting. Also, the next paragraph should briefly explain the plot turns and the major character so that the work would make sense to your audience or readers.

The last paragraphs could contain information that shows how conflicts are resolved. When you align with this tip for formatting a synopsis format, your work would be clear and your readers won’t be confused.
